I tried that one Tetsu Kasuya recipe more or less (I wasn’t too concerned with timing and I used a larger dose than is quite practical and had to fudge by adding a bit more water during the final drawdown. I also used a different ratio.) It did a pretty good job with Colorfull’s Wilton Benitez decaf, which is a coffee I have no complaints about but which I have not been getting the most out of, perhaps.

For my personal brewing, this recipe might be unnecessarily complex, since from a flavor standpoint, I think I can get similar results with bypass recipes more easily. Probably this recipe stands out for folks who need more body in their coffee, something that as a tea person I don’t really ever miss.

Next time I should try just doing an immersion soak and single drawdown, since I haven’t done an immersion brew in living memory.

I have not yet tried the Mugen swap, but I have a Mugen so I will definitely do so at some point.
